在线氨氮测定仪的数据处理与远程监控系统的开发是一个综合性的项目,涉及传感器技术、数据采集与处理、远程通信以及软件开发等多个方面。以下是对该系统的详细分析: 
一、在线氨氮测定仪的工作原理 在线氨氮测定仪通常基于特定的化学反应和电化学传感技术来测量水体中的氨氮浓度。这些仪器利用特定的试剂与水样中的氨氮发生反应,如氧化反应生成亚硝酸盐或氮氧化物,然后通过传感器检测反应产物的浓度,从而推算出氨氮的浓度。主要的方法包括尿素酶法、硝酸还原法和电化学法。 二、数据处理系统 数据采集:在线氨氮测定仪通过内置的传感器实时采集水样中的氨氮数据,并将其转换为电信号进行传输。 数据预处理:采集到的原始数据可能包含噪声或异常值,因此需要进行预处理,如滤波、平滑和异常值剔除等,以提高数据的准确性和可靠性。 数据分析:经过预处理的数据需要进行进一步的分析,以提取有用的信息。这包括计算平均值、标准差等统计量,以及进行趋势分析、相关性分析等。 数据存储:处理后的数据需要存储在数据库中,以便后续查询和分析。数据库设计应考虑到数据的完整性、一致性。 三、远程监控系统开发 硬件平台:为了能够实现远程监控,需要选择加入无线通讯模块,将氨氮水质监测仪放入步入式环境试验箱内搭建可靠性测试系统的硬件平台。 软件平台: 开发框架:可以采用如QT等应用程序框架进行开发,这些框架提供了良好的交互界面和丰富的功能模块,有助于缩短开发周期。 通信协议:远程监控系统需要与支持无线通讯的在线氨氮测定仪进行通信,因此需要选择合适的通信协议,如TCP/IP、MQTT等。这些协议能够确保数据的实时传输和可靠性。 用户界面:用户界面应简洁明了,方便用户查看实时监测数据、历史数据和报警信息。同时,用户界面还应提供数据导出、报表生成等功能,以满足用户的不同需求。 功能实现: 实时监测:通过远程监控系统,用户可以实时查看在线氨氮测定仪采集的数据,了解水质状况。 历史数据查询:用户可以查询历史数据,以便进行趋势分析和对比。 报警功能:当水质参数超过预设阈值时,系统应能够自动触发报警,提醒用户采取相应措施。 远程配置:用户可以通过远程监控系统对在线氨氮测定仪进行远程配置,如设置采样频率、校准参数等。 四、可靠性 数据加密:为了确保数据传输的正常,应采用数据加密技术,防止数据在传输过程中被窃取或篡改。 访问控制:远程监控系统应提供严格的访问控制机制,确保只有授权用户才能访问系统。 故障恢复:系统应具备良好的故障恢复能力,当出现故障时能够迅速恢复正常运行。 在线氨氮测定仪的数据处理与远程监控系统的开发需要综合考虑多个方面,包括工作原理、数据处理、远程通信和软件开发等。通过合理的系统设计和开发流程,可以实现准确和可靠的水质监测和管理。
|